Who Will Win? Roland Garros: Zverev-Cobolli and Griekspoor-Quinn Predictions
The French Open, or Roland Garros, is in full swing, and tennis fans worldwide are glued to their screens. This year's tournament is rife with upsets and unexpected performances, making predictions even more challenging. But let's dive into two intriguing first-round matchups: Alexander Zverev vs. Giulio Cobolli and Tallon Griekspoor vs. Bernabe Zapata Miralles (Quinn was originally listed but Miralles is the actual opponent). Who will emerge victorious?
Alexander Zverev vs. Giulio Cobolli: A Clash of Generations
This match pits the seasoned experience of Alexander Zverev against the rising star, Giulio Cobolli. Zverev, a former world number two and a Roland Garros semi-finalist, boasts a powerful serve and a devastating forehand. However, his recent form has been inconsistent, hampered by injuries. Cobolli, on the other hand, is a young Italian talent known for his aggressive baseline play and unwavering determination. He's proven he can compete at the highest level, upsetting higher-ranked players in the past.
Prediction: While Cobolli possesses undeniable talent and fighting spirit, Zverev's superior experience and power should give him the edge in this matchup. The German's serve will be crucial, and if he can maintain his focus, he should be able to navigate Cobolli's aggressive style. Our prediction: Zverev in four sets.
Tallon Griekspoor vs. Bernabe Zapata Miralles: A Battle of Baseline Power
This encounter promises a thrilling baseline battle between two players known for their consistency and powerful groundstrokes. Tallon Griekspoor, the Dutch powerhouse, has been climbing the ATP rankings steadily, showcasing improved consistency and a more aggressive approach. His forehand is a significant weapon, capable of dictating points. Facing him is Bernabe Zapata Miralles, a Spaniard who is renowned for his tenacity and ability to grind out points. His defensive prowess and relentless retrieval make him a difficult opponent to overcome.
Prediction: This match is significantly harder to call. Both players possess similar strengths, and it could easily go either way. Griekspoor's slightly more aggressive style might give him a slight advantage, but Zapata Miralles' resilience could prove decisive in a long, drawn-out match. The key will be who can maintain their focus and minimize unforced errors. Our prediction: Griekspoor in five sets. This one is likely to be a nail-biter!
Beyond the Predictions: Key Factors to Consider
Several factors beyond individual player form can influence the outcomes of these matches:
- Court Conditions: The Roland Garros clay is notoriously slow, favoring players with consistent groundstrokes and excellent court coverage.
- Mental Fortitude: Maintaining focus and managing pressure under the intense atmosphere of a Grand Slam tournament is crucial.
- Physical Fitness: Five-set matches on clay are physically demanding; endurance will play a significant role.
